Dayton City Demographics
Dayton city spans Montgomery and a small part of Greene County, Ohio. As of 2022, Dayton’s population is approximately 137,500. The median age is about 34.8 years, with 48.8% male and 51.2% female residents. Racially, Dayton is 56% White, 38% Black or African American, 1.3% Asian, 4.4% Hispanic or Latino, and around 3% identifying as two or more races, reflecting the city’s diverse demographic profile.

Transportation in Dayton City
Dayton, located near Greene County, Ohio, features extensive transportation infrastructure, including Interstate 75 and U.S. Route 35. The Greater Dayton Regional Transit Authority serves about 3 million annual riders, with public transit accounting for roughly 2% of commutes, while 83% drive alone. The average commute time is 21 minutes. Vehicle ownership is high, with about 90% of households having at least one car. Major employment hubs include Wright-Patterson Air Force Base and downtown Dayton, contributing significantly to local commuting patterns and economic activity.
Dayton City Healthcare
Dayton city, near Greene County, OH, is served by major hospitals such as Miami Valley Hospital and Kettering Health Dayton, alongside over 40 clinics. Approximately 90% of residents have health insurance coverage. Dayton's patient demographics are 53% White, 39% Black, and 3% Hispanic. Common health issues include heart disease, diabetes, and opioid use disorder. Healthcare access is bolstered by 2,500 healthcare providers in Montgomery County, with a patient-to-primary care physician ratio of about 1,500:1. Medicaid covers 30% of the population, and 11% are uninsured, reflecting ongoing disparities in healthcare access.
